A high-reliability electronics manufacturing facility in Huntsville, Alabama, is seeking a meticulous SMT & BGA Rework Technician to assemble and repair complex RF and microwave printed circuit boards. In the defense sector, a single cold solder joint can mean a failed mission. We need a technician who treats every microscopic component with absolute precision and respect for IPC standards.
1. Performing intricate surface-mount assembly and rework on high-density, multi-layer RF PCBs, handling ultra-miniature components like 0402, 0201, and 01005 under a high-powered binocular microscope.
2. Executing flawless BGA (Ball Grid Array) and QFN reballing, removal, and replacement using precision infrared (IR) and hot-air rework stations, strictly adhering to specific thermal profiles for lead-free and leaded solders.
3. Terminating and soldering delicate high-frequency coaxial connectors and micro-strip lines directly onto the board edges, ensuring minimal signal reflection.
4. Applying specialized conformal coatings, moisture-barrier compounds, and RF shielding enclosures to protect the assemblies from harsh field environments.
5. Rigorously cleaning and inspecting all flux residues and solder joints to maintain strict IPC-A-610 Class 3 compliance.
